Hoshino (星野村, Hoshino-mura) was a village located in Yame District, Fukuoka Prefecture, Japan.
As of 2003, the village had an estimated population of 3,707 and a density of 45.61 persons per km2. The total area was 81.28 km2.
On February 1, 2010, Hoshino, along with the towns of Kurogi and Tachibana, and the village of Yabe (all from Yame District), was merged into the expanded city of Yame.
